## Feature toggle types
Here's the list of the feature toggle types that Unleash supports together with their intended use case and expected lifetime:
- **Release** - Enable trunk-based development for teams practicing Continuous Delivery. _Expected lifetime 40 days_
- **Experiment** - Perform multivariate or A/B testing. _Expected lifetime 40 days_
- **Operational** - Control operational aspects of the system's behavior. _Expected lifetime 7 days_
- **Kill switch** - Gracefully degrade system functionality. _(permanent)_
- **Permission** - Change the features or product experience that certain users receive. _(permanent)_
## Deprecating a feature toggle {#deprecate-a-feature-toggle}
You can mark feature toggles as `stale`. This is a way to deprecate a feature toggle without removing the active configuration for connected applications. Use this to signal that you should stop using the feature in your applications.
The `stale` property can utilized to help us manage ["feature toggle debt"](/user_guide/technical_debt) in various ways:
- Inform the developer working locally when we detect usage of a stale feature toggle.
- Use it to break the build if the code contains stale feature toggles.
